As not much is known about the religious practices of the Vikings, those seen in the series are mostly fictional, and licking the hand of the Seer came up as a sign of respect towards someone with contact with the gods. I remember reading somewhere that the licking of the hand was a way to basically seal the deal.. meaning she goes in before the session offers him something.. then he answers her question to the best of his ability and then she licks the hand accepting the finality of the answer the seer gave her and she is also acknowledging the sealed deal that she made in the beginning.
